Comparison of vascular access patency and patient survival between native arteriovenous fistula and synthetic arteriovenous graft according to age group

Arteriovenous fistula (AVF) is historically known to be the ideal option for vascular access (VA) for hemodialysis compared with arteriovenous graft (AVG). However, this approach has been recently questioned in the aging population because of their poor vessel quality and multiple comorbidities.
